Exploring Seattle Apartments for Rent Across Diverse Neighborhoods


Seattle offers a unique blend of city energy and access to nature. Neighborhoods like Capitol Hill, Ballard, and downtown provide walkable access to dining, entertainment, and employment centers. Other areas offer a more relaxed pace while still maintaining strong transit connections.

Seattle apartments for rent are available across a wide range of styles and price points, including:


  • Studio and one-bedroom apartments for professionals and students

  • Larger units suited for families or shared living

  • Properties close to transit, parks, and waterfront access

Understanding neighborhood characteristics is key to finding an apartment that aligns with your daily routine and lifestyle.

Simplifying Your Search for Seattle Apartments for Rent


A successful apartment search depends on having access to clear information. Pricing, unit size, amenities, and location should be easy to compare so renters can make informed decisions.


When evaluating Seattle apartments for rent, it’s important to consider:


  • Monthly rent in relation to neighborhood averages

  • Commute time and transit availability

  • Proximity to grocery stores, parks, and daily essentials

Using filters and clear criteria helps narrow options efficiently and avoids unnecessary guesswork.

Finding Value and Availability in the Seattle Rental Market


Seattle’s rental market moves quickly, with many apartments becoming available and leasing within short timeframes. Some properties may offer move-in incentives or limited-time pricing, making it important to stay informed and prepared.


By monitoring availability and understanding current market conditions, renters can identify opportunities that align with both budget and lifestyle preferences.

Seattle’s strong economic foundation is built on major employers like Amazon, Microsoft, and a thriving healthcare sector. These companies not only attract new residents but also create a steady demand for rental housing. For investors, this translates into a consistent tenant pool and the potential for long-term income growth. Multifamily properties, in particular, offer diversification through multiple rental units, reducing vacancy risk and providing more stable cash flow compared to single-family homes. Market Trends to Watch Despite new construction, Seattle’s housing supply remains constrained, pushing rental rates upward. Vacancy rates are low, recently recorded at around 3.2%, and median rents continue to climb. Neighborhoods such as Capitol Hill, Ballard, and Fremont remain in high demand thanks to their amenities, walkability, and proximity to transit. Investors looking to buy Seattle investment property need to consider these dynamics carefully. A property’s location, unit mix, and condition can make all the difference in achieving sustainable returns. Financing and ROI Considerations Investment mortgages often require larger down payments—typically 20–25%—and slightly higher interest rates than primary residences. Before purchasing, it’s critical to calculate projected rental income, subtract operating expenses, and evaluate cash flow. Essential costs include: Mortgage payments Property taxes and insurance Maintenance and vacancy allowances Professional management fees (if applicable) These calculations help ensure the property not only produces income from day one but also fits your long-term investment strategy.
